Playbill Air Как работи приложението "port" - Архив
„Еър“ попита „Яндекс“ за трика в приложението „Транспорт“, благодарение на което автобусите на неговата карта се носят като във вълшебен сън - и как тази полезна програма работи като цяло.

Идеята за Yandex.Transport получихме преди повече от три години. Тогава автобусните маркери се появиха в нашия мобилен Yandex.Maps като отделен слой. Те бяха на разположение в шест региона, където се съгласихме да получаваме данни от превозвачи: Казан, Омск, Нижни Новгород, Перм, Московска област и Новосибирск. Но тогава „Карти“ с техния слой задръствания и планиране на маршрути се използваха предимно от автомобилистите. За да не им пречи, слоят обществен транспорт трябваше да бъде заровен доста дълбоко. Следователно този слой вероятно нямаше голяма аудитория в Yandex.Maps. Въпреки че е ясно, че в Русия има много повече пешеходци, отколкото автомобилисти, освен това мнозина по време на социологическите проучвания отбелязват, че им липсва услуга за обществения транспорт.
Yandex.Transport работи по този начин. Всяко превозно средство е оборудвано с GPS и GLONASS устройства, които веднъж на всеки 20-60 секунди предават сигнали за своето местоположение чрез мобилния интернет на сървъра на превозвача. Инсталирането на тези устройства се извършва от самите превозвачи, общински и частни. Сега приложението в Москва има достъп до информация за 758 автобусни, 80 тролейбусни и 38 трамвайни маршрута, както и 350 маршрута на Автолайн. Получаваме от превозвачите идентификационния номер на превозното средство, номер на маршрута, вид транспорт (автобус, тролейбус, трамвай или микробус), време за сигнал и координати, географска ширина и дължина. Имаме траекториите на маршрутите от всички номера и проверяваме отново дали автобус 28 всъщност пътува по маршрута на автобус 28. Това се прави с цел да се изключат превозни средства, които по някаква причина са напуснали своя маршрут.